Hello, do you know solution for this one The fluid displacement technique is used to find the porosity of a certain core sample. The sample is first coated with paraffin (density of 0.9 g/cm3) and submerged in a beaker filled with water (density 1 g/cm3), where the volume of water before and after submerging the sample is recorded. Then, the paraffin is removed, the sample is saturated with water and then weighed. The following information is given for the sample:
- Dry weight of the core = 140.2 g
- Weight of the core with paraffin = 145.6 g
- Initial volume in the beaker = 242.5 cm3
- Final volume in the beaker = 318.0 cm3
- Weight of the core saturated with water = 156.8 g

Can I do the same without the vacuum pump? Thank for the video :)
It is not advised as the pore volume will be filled by both water and air. This will cause errors when measuring the porosity.
